Tisbury FinCom authorizes FY26 interdepartmental transfers under state law

Tisbury Finance and Advisory Committee · May 20, 2026

FinCom authorized the Town Accountant and Treasurer/Finance Director to make FY2026 interdepartmental and line‑item transfers in accordance with Massachusetts General Law, Chapter 44 Section 33B. Motion passed unanimously.

At its May 20 meeting the Tisbury Finance and Advisory Committee moved to authorize the Town Accountant and the Treasurer/Finance Director to make fiscal year 2026 interdepartmental and line‑item transfers under Massachusetts General Law, Chapter 44 Section 33B. The motion, moved by Allan Rogers and seconded by Alex Meleney, passed unanimously (6 AYES).

Committee members said FY25 transfers had been minimal and asked staff to identify which departments were in deficit. FinCom noted this authorization is an annual housekeeping measure intended to allow end‑of‑year adjustments without a separate vote for each transfer.
